ULIBARRI -- Florentino Ulibarri, 83, a beloved husband and father, passed away on Tuesday, September 28, 2004. He is survived by his wife of 57 years, Grace; sons, Ernest Ulibarri and wife, Julia of Fairfax, VA; and two grandsons, Matthew Ulibarri and Zachary Ulibarri. Mr. Ulibarri was from Las Vegas, NM, where he met his loving bride. The war took him away to the Pacific when he served in the China-Burma-India Theater. He raised his family in Los Alamos and retired to Albuquerque in 1985. Mr. Ulibarri was a skilled hunter and fisherman, and later in life enjoyed golf. All of us will miss his hearty laugh and cunning sense of humor.
